.page_container__Vca_C{display:flex;justify-content:center;align-items:center;min-height:100vh;background:linear-gradient(135deg,var(--askie-color-neutral-100),var(--askie-color-background-end));padding:var(--askie-spacing-l)}.page_card__X3QWx{background:var(--askie-color-card-background);border-radius:var(--askie-radius-large);border:1px solid var(--askie-color-border);padding:var(--askie-spacing-xxl) var(--askie-spacing-xl);max-width:420px;width:100%;text-align:center}.page_logo__ZGHYX{margin-bottom:var(--askie-spacing-xl)}.page_logoImage__rf0Dl{width:64px;height:64px;margin-bottom:var(--askie-spacing-m)}.page_title__FJ98c{font-size:24px;font-weight:700;color:var(--askie-color-text-primary);margin:0 0 var(--askie-spacing-xs) 0}.page_subtitle__BGgy1{font-size:15px;color:var(--askie-color-text-secondary);margin:0}.page_options__8MlN_{display:flex;flex-direction:column;gap:var(--askie-spacing-m)}.page_googleButton__OvZ9l{display:flex;align-items:center;justify-content:center;gap:var(--askie-spacing-s);background:white;color:#3c4043;border:1px solid #dadce0;border-radius:var(--askie-radius-medium);padding:var(--askie-spacing-m) var(--askie-spacing-l);font-size:16px;font-weight:600;cursor:pointer;text-decoration:none;transition:background .2s,box-shadow .2s;height:48px}.page_googleButton__OvZ9l:hover{background:#f8f9fa;box-shadow:0 1px 3px rgba(0,0,0,.1)}.page_divider___sNyE{display:flex;align-items:center;gap:var(--askie-spacing-m);color:var(--askie-color-text-tertiary);font-size:14px}.page_divider___sNyE:after,.page_divider___sNyE:before{content:"";flex:1 1;height:1px;background:var(--askie-color-border)}.page_codeButton__GUJ9n{display:flex;align-items:center;justify-content:center;gap:var(--askie-spacing-s);background:var(--askie-color-surface-elevated);color:var(--askie-color-text-primary);border:1px solid var(--askie-color-border);border-radius:var(--askie-radius-medium);padding:var(--askie-spacing-m) var(--askie-spacing-l);font-size:16px;font-weight:600;cursor:pointer;text-decoration:none;transition:background .2s;height:48px}.page_codeButton__GUJ9n:hover{background:var(--askie-color-border)}.page_backLink__kbHCw{display:inline-block;margin-top:var(--askie-spacing-l);color:var(--askie-color-text-secondary);font-size:14px;text-decoration:none}.page_backLink__kbHCw:hover{color:var(--askie-color-primary)}@media (max-width:480px){.page_card__X3QWx{padding:var(--askie-spacing-xl) var(--askie-spacing-l)}}